Geology of Egypt ... by W. F. Hume; with preface by Col. H. G. Lyons; and a bibliography.

Contents:
I. The surface features of Egypt, their determining causes and relation to geological structure.--II. The fundamental Pre-Cambrian rocks of Egypt and the Sudan; their distribution age and character.--pt. 1. The metamorphic rocks, with preface by H. H. Thomas.--pt. 2. The later plutonic and minor intrusive rocks, with a special chapter dealing with dynamical geology (cataract structure and contact metamorphism) and the age of the Pre-Cambrian rocks in Egypt.--pt. 3. The minerals of economic value associated with the intrusive Pre-Cambrian igneous rocks and ancient sediments and methods suggested for the dating of historical and geological times. Written in collaboration with R. H. Greaves.
